The garage occupancy feed for the Brindlewood campus arrives over a message queue every thirty seconds, one record per level, published by the Stallgrid edge boxes. Counts can briefly go negative when a sensor double-fires on exit; the ingest job clamps these to zero and flags the interval. If the feed stalls for more than five minutes, the dashboard falls back to the last known snapshot. Sensor mappings, queue names, and the replay procedure are documented on the internal page below.

runbook for tahog-kadug: https://gitlab.qirvanworks.corp/projects/pages/view/b139298aed28

Subject: DR drill — reminder job failover (please read carefully)

Welcome aboard. This Thursday we rehearse failover for the Meadowgate clinic appointment reminder job. During the drill, the primary scheduler in the Ashvale region is deliberately halted; the standby must pick up the reminder queue within five minutes without duplicating messages to patients. Watch the dedup ledger closely and note any gaps. To assume the standby operator role, authenticate with the passphrase below.

unlock words, yagep-fahof: belix-rusvan-casdor-gorox-aldath-norael-istix-quenael-fraeth-silael

## Ownership

The Coinloom conversion module handles all currency math, and yes, the rounding errors you're auditing live here. We round half-even at the minor-unit boundary, and any drift beyond one unit per transaction is a bug worth flagging. Security-relevant findings (e.g., accumulation attacks) go straight to the module owner, named right below.

account owner for bawip-tahag: Raleth Quenok

Short version: the docs linter treats anything in the macros folder as customer-facing prose, so it complains about passive voice and missing alt text even in internal snippets. We know, it's annoying. You can suppress a rule with an inline directive, but please don't blanket-disable the whole file — the style checks genuinely catch embarrassing typos before they hit customers. A proper internal-docs profile is coming next sprint. To edit the linter config in the admin panel, use the passphrase below.

strongbox words: ulaath-norax